## This file runs all tests from 'tst/testinstall' and 'tst/teststandard'
## directories of the GAP distribution.
##
## <#GAPDoc Label="[1]{teststandard.g}">
## If you want to run a more advanced check (this is not required and
## make take up to an hour), you can read <File>teststandard.g</File>
## which is an extended test script performing all tests from the
## <File>tst</File> directory.
## <P/>
## <Log><![CDATA[
## gap> Read( Filename( DirectoriesLibrary( "tst" ), "teststandard.g" ) );
## ]]></Log>
## <P/>
## The test requires up to 1 GB of memory and runs about one hour on an
## Intel Core 2 Duo / 2.53 GHz machine, and produces an output similar
## to the <File>testinstall.g</File> test.
## <#/GAPDoc>
